Fix Boot Camp Control panel doesn't see macOS drive/partition

Problem: Boot Camp Control panel on Windows 10 doesn’t display macOS drive/partition which you could select to boot into.

Cause: The Boot Camp utility is not able to read APFS drive/partitions. The most recent Boot Camp version is currently available only for iMacPro1,1.

Solution: Basically you need to update to Boot Camp 6.1 or later.

  1. Install 7Zip
  2. Install and run Brigadier it using the –model parameter:
 brigadier.exe --model iMacPro1,1

and run the Boot Camp installer manually:

 msiexec /i BootCamp-041-55643\BootCamp\Drivers\Apple\BootCamp.msi
